Jack Walsh: Ospreys confirm versatile back will leave for Montauban

Walsh was born in the United States of America before becoming a graduate of the New South Wales Waratahs academy and he represented Australia Under-18s.

He played for club side Manly Marlins in Sydney before heading to the UK in 2020 where he made eight appearances for Exeter.

Walsh, who would have qualified to play for Wales on residency in the next 12 months, outlined why he was leaving.

“Ospreys means a lot to me, so this was a tough decision to make,” said Walsh.

“I am grateful for the time I’ve spent at the Ospreys, I’ve grown a lot as a player and a person since I joined the team and want to thank everyone who has played a part in that.

“I have made lifelong friends, and the Osprey supporters have been amazing throughout my time at the region.

“I’d like to thank Mark [Jones], the coaches and all staff, it’s an amazing place to come to work every day.

“While it’s a bittersweet moment, I’m excited to embrace this opportunity and test myself in a new environment.”
